Innovent Biologics,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company committed to developing and commercializing high-quality innovative therapeutics that are affordable to ordinary people. The company has built a fully integrated multi-functional biopharmaceutical platform consisting of research, chemistry, manufacturing, and clinical development capabilities. It has developed a pipeline covering a variety of novel and validated therapeutic targets and drug modalities, including monoclonal antibodies, multi-specific antibodies, cell engagers, antibody-drug conjugates (ADCs), immuno-cytokines, cell therapies, and small molecules. The pipeline spans multiple major therapeutic areas including oncology, cardiovascular and metabolic diseases, autoimmune disorders, and ophthalmology, with significant clinical and commercial potential as both monotherapies and combination therapies to address unmet medical needs.

Products and Services
The company offers a diverse range of products primarily in the biopharmaceutical arena, focusing on innovative therapeutics to treat various diseases. The company has developed monoclonal antibodies, bispecific antibodies, cell therapies, and small molecules, which address critical therapeutic areas. The oncology therapeutic candidates are particularly noteworthy, with several products already approved and marketed.
Among its flagship products are monoclonal antibody therapies targeting oncogenic drivers and immune modulation, including drugs like TYVYT® (sintilimab injection), which serves as a PD-1 inhibitor for treating various cancers. Similarly, BYVASDA® (bevacizumab injection) and HALPRYZA® (rituximab injection) have also established their presence in the oncology treatment landscape.
Geographical Markets Served
The company primarily serves the Greater China market, including Mainland China, Hong Kong, Taiwan, and Macau, but is also establishing a foothold in global markets through strategic collaborations and partnerships.
